Position Summary

CVS Health has an opportunity for a full-time Senior Financial Analyst. The Rebate Finance Operations – Client Support team is innovative, fast-paced, and in a consistent state of change, requiring a professional, detail-oriented, and flexible individual with strong analytical and time management skills. The Senior Financial Analyst will work autonomously on set deliverables while maintaining the strategy for continuous improvement. This role will be instrumental in maintaining and improving the team’s rebate payment calculation, reporting, and communication processes.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Managing a robust calendar of rebate payment deliverables and answering related client inquiries.
  • Serving as the primary point of contact for the client on any payment or collection-related inquiries (this is a client-facing role).
  • Performing detailed manual calculations, large standard payment reconciliations, and thorough historical payment research projects.
  • Utilizing Microsoft Access, SQL, Microsoft Excel, enterprise accounting platforms (SAP), and enterprise client registration systems.
  • Completing deliverables autonomously in accordance with team standards and contractual obligations.
  • Collaborating with other team members to manage and track all payment deliverables.
  • Managing and facilitating special projects aimed at streamlining and automating payment processes, including the creation of communication and training plans.
  • Relaying details on large payments to senior leadership and working with internal audit teams to provide standard reporting and improve processes.
  • Managing a consistent workload of requests and inquiries through a workload management platform (Salesforce/Smartsheet).

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
